The texts she read all agree that it's not so simple as starting with a glob of lead: the prima materia of alchemy must be discovered, with the help of whatever ancient volumes and divine powers the alchemist may choose to call on. Their clues to whether they've found the right substance are as follows: it's everywhere; it's the macrocosm; it's the microcosm; it's undifferentiated; it's a solid dark mass of chaos; it's a black, somewhat viscous, semi-solid gooey thing. There's a 17th century etching showing the prima materia as swirling masses of a substance somewhat like clouds, sort of like wind, sort of like animals, sort of like humans, all dark and confused. The prima materia is not only the shadowy glob in the alchemist's crucible, but also the dark confusion and chaos in the psyche of the person starting out on the journey of the Great Work.
